serializeArray()
method
The serializeArray() method creates an array of objects
(name and value) by serializing form values.You can select one or more form
elements (like input and/or text area), or the form element itself.
Syntex:
$(selector).serializeArray()

<!DOCTYPE html>
<html>
<head>
<script
src="https://ajax.googleapis.com/ajax/libs/jquery/3.2.1/jquery.min.js"></script>
<script>
$(document).ready(function(){
$("button").click(function(){
var x =
$("form").serializeArray();
$.each(x, function(i,
field){
$("#results").append(field.name + ":" +
field.value + " ");
});
});
});
</script>
</head>
<body>
<form action="">
First name: <input
type="text" name="FirstName"
value="Nitin"><br>
Last name: <input
type="text" name="LastName"
value="Chauhan"><br>
</form>
<button>Serialize form values</button>
<div id="results"></div>
</body>
</html>
